Services and pricing

Concrete work pricing varies sharply by application. A basic 4-inch residential driveway runs roughly $8 to $12 per square foot installed in Oklahoma City, meaning a 500-square-foot driveway costs between $4,000 and $6,000. Stamped or decorative concrete commands a premium, typically $12 to $18 per square foot. Masonry pricing depends on material and complexity: brick veneer on a house exterior runs $12 to $20 per square foot, while stone work costs more. Concrete repair (patching, resurfacing) charges by the hour or by the job, generally $75 to $125 per hour for labor. Confirm current rates directly, as concrete material costs shift with fuel and commodity prices.

S&S typically provides a site visit and written estimate at no charge. The estimate should itemize materials, labor, equipment, and timeline. A deposit (often 25 to 50 percent) is standard before work begins, with the balance due upon completion or within agreed milestones on larger jobs.

How S&S Construction compares to other Oklahoma City masonry contractors

Oklahoma City has a dense field of masonry and concrete providers. Larger outfits like Crete Plus or established regional contractors often bid lower on high-volume jobs (new subdivisions, major commercial slabs) because they have fixed overhead spread across many projects. S&S Construction typically competes on responsiveness and customization for homeowners and smaller contractors who need a single dedicated point of contact rather than a project manager juggling dozens of concurrent jobs.

Mid-sized local firms such as those advertising in the OKC Building Trades Directory often match or undercut S&S on price, but reputation and insurance verification matter more than rate alone. Verify that any contractor holds an Oklahoma contractor license, carries general liability insurance (minimum $1 million), and is bonded for the job size. S&S should provide proof of insurance before signing a contract.

For decorative or high-end finishes, specialty concrete shops (which focus solely on stamped, polished, or epoxy work) may deliver superior aesthetics but command higher rates and longer waits. Choose S&S for straightforward, solid work on driveways, patios, and repair jobs; choose a specialty finisher if you want architectural concrete that doubles as a design feature.

What the first visit involves

Contact S&S Construction by phone or email to describe the job (size, scope, location, timeline). Most contractors ask for photos and specifics: existing surface condition, square footage, design preferences, and site access. A site visit follows, typically within a few days during off-season, longer during spring and summer. The estimator walks the property, discusses options, and answers questions about durability (OKC freeze-thaw cycles warrant reinforcement and proper drainage) and maintenance.

The written estimate arrives within one week. Review it for detail: what materials, what's included versus excluded (site prep, debris removal, sealing), timeline, and payment terms. Ask about warranty (concrete typically warrants 1 to 3 years against defects in labor and material, not against settling or environmental damage).
